What Counts as High Value Metal?

High value metals typically include materials used in high-temperature, high-pressure or precision environments. These alloys are engineered for strength, corrosion resistance and thermal stability.

Common examples include titanium alloys, nickel-based super alloys, cobalt alloys and aerospace-grade components removed during overhaul cycles. Turbine blades, aircraft structural parts and precision engineering components fall into this category.

Unlike mixed scrap streams, these metals must be segregated and identified correctly to protect their value.

Why Super Alloys Require Specialist Handling

Super alloys are often used in aerospace engines, power generation systems and high-performance industrial applications. Their composition can include nickel, chromium, cobalt, molybdenum and other rare elements.

Because these materials are expensive to produce and energy intensive to refine, recycling plays an essential role in the supply chain.

Improper mixing of high value alloys with lower-grade scrap can significantly reduce recoverable value. Accurate segregation, controlled storage and correct documentation protect both pricing and compliance.

How High Value Metal Is Assessed and Priced

Pricing for high value metal recycling in London depends on several factors:

  • Material composition
  • Alloy grade and certification
  • Quantity
  • Contamination levels
  • Current global market demand

 

Unlike standard ferrous scrap, high-performance alloys may require testing or verification before final valuation. Clean, clearly separated materials typically achieve stronger rates than mixed or contaminated loads.

The Role of Rare and Critical Metals

Beyond titanium and nickel alloys, certain operations generate smaller volumes of critical metals such as tantalum, niobium, hafnium and rhenium. These materials are strategically important within aerospace, nuclear and semiconductor industries.

Recycling rare metals reduces reliance on raw extraction and supports sustainable material cycles. It also provides financial return for materials that might otherwise be overlooked in mixed scrap streams.

Correct identification of these metals requires technical understanding and careful segregation.

 

Storage and Segregation Best Practice

High value metal recycling outcomes improve significantly when materials are stored correctly. Dedicated bins or containers for specific alloys prevent cross-contamination. Covered storage reduces exposure to moisture and environmental contamination.

Clear labelling of materials by alloy type or component origin assists grading accuracy. Communication between site managers and recycling partners supports efficient collection scheduling.

Even simple improvements in scrap management practices can increase overall recovered value.
